Orange is a color that commands attention. It’s a warm, energetic hue, a blend of the stimulating red and the cheerful yellow. In color psychology, orange is associated with enthusiasm, creativity, happiness, determination, attraction, success, encouragement, and stimulation. These attributes make it a potentially powerful choice for spaces like kitchens, dining areas, or children's rooms – places where vitality and warmth are welcomed. However, its boldness also means it requires a considered approach to achieve harmony rather than overwhelm.
When considering orange edge banding for cabinets, designers and homeowners are often aiming for a distinctive look. It’s a departure from the traditional neutrals like white, grey, or wood grain, and it instantly injects personality into a space. The "good-looking" aspect, therefore, hinges on several factors: the specific shade of orange, the cabinet material and color it's paired with, the overall interior design theme, and the quality of the edge banding itself.
The Spectrum of Orange: Finding Your Hue
Just like there isn't one "red" or one "blue," orange comes in a vast array of shades, each with its own character and design potential.
Bright Tangerine/Traffic Cone Orange: These are the most vibrant and energetic oranges. They are perfect for creating a playful, modern, or even avant-garde look. Often seen in commercial spaces seeking a strong brand identity or in contemporary kitchens designed for a bold statement. Paired with crisp whites, deep charcoals, or even contrasting blues, a bright orange edge band can become the focal point.
Burnt Orange/Terracotta: These deeper, more muted oranges carry an earthy, rustic, and sophisticated vibe. They evoke warmth and comfort, making them ideal for Mediterranean, Southwestern, or bohemian interior styles. A burnt orange edge band on dark wood veneer cabinets or alongside creams and greens can create a rich, inviting atmosphere.
Peach/Coral: Lighter, softer oranges that lean towards pink or yellow. These shades offer a gentle warmth and a touch of sweetness. They work wonderfully in lighter, airy spaces, providing a subtle pop of color without being overwhelming. They can complement light wood grains, pale greys, or even act as a pastel accent in minimalist designs.
Amber/Rust: These shades combine orange with brown undertones, offering a classic, almost vintage appeal. They can lend a sense of history and depth, often seen in mid-century modern designs or industrial-chic settings when paired with metals and raw materials.

Designing with Orange Edge Banding: Strategies for Success
To make orange edge banding "good-looking," it's crucial to integrate it thoughtfully into the broader design scheme.
Contrast and Complement: Orange thrives when paired effectively.
With Neutrals: White, grey, black, and natural wood tones serve as excellent backdrops for orange. A bright orange edge band against white cabinet fronts creates a clean, modern, and energetic look. Against a charcoal grey, it pops with sophistication. With light wood, it adds warmth without being too stark.
With Analogous Colors: Combining orange with red or yellow cabinet fronts (or vice versa) can create a vibrant, harmonious, and warm palette. This is a bold choice that can be very effective in creative or artistic spaces.
With Complementary Colors: Blue is orange's complementary color. Using an orange edge band with blue cabinet fronts (especially a muted navy or a deep teal) creates a dynamic and balanced contrast. This combination is striking and modern.
Material and Finish Harmony: The texture and finish of the cabinet material play a huge role.
High Gloss Orange: For a sleek, contemporary, and futuristic look, a high-gloss orange edge band can be stunning on high-gloss cabinet doors, particularly in white or black. It reflects light, enhancing the vibrancy.
Matte Orange: A matte orange finish offers a softer, more understated look. It's excellent for rustic, Scandinavian, or minimalist designs, providing warmth without the reflectivity of gloss. It can pair beautifully with matte laminate or painted MDF cabinet fronts.
Wood Grain Integration: When used with wood grain cabinets, the specific tone of orange needs careful consideration. A burnt orange might complement a dark walnut, while a peach could soften a light maple.
Scale and Proportion: Consider the size of the room and the amount of orange being introduced. In a small kitchen, a vibrant orange edge band might be enough to make a statement without overwhelming the space. In a larger kitchen, it could be used more extensively or even paired with orange cabinet doors for maximum impact, provided the rest of the elements (countertops, backsplash, flooring) remain neutral.
Lighting: How natural and artificial light interacts with the orange edge banding will significantly affect its perceived color. Warm lighting can enhance its coziness, while cool lighting might make it appear sharper. We always recommend our clients test samples in their actual space under various lighting conditions.
Longevity vs. Trend: While orange can be trendy, classic shades like burnt orange or terracotta have a timeless appeal. For highly trendy shades, consider using them in areas that are easier to update, or balance them with timeless surrounding elements. Premium Raw Materials: We meticulously source high-quality P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ride), ABS (Acrylonitrile Butadiene Styrene), and Acrylic granules. For orange edge banding, the purity of pigments is crucial to achieve vibrant, consistent, and fade-resistant colors. Inferior pigments can lead to dullness, uneven color, or rapid fading under UV exposure. Our materials are rigorously tested to ensure they meet international standards for durability and safety.
Precision Manufacturing: Our state-of-the-art extrusion lines are equipped with advanced sensors and control systems to ensure precise thickness, width, and consistent coloration throughout the entire roll. Even a slight variation in thickness can affect the application process and the finished look of the cabinet. We achieve tolerances down to hundredths of a millimeter, ensuring a seamless finish.
